Bounds on moments of weighted sums of finite Riesz products

Published 28 May 2018 in math.FA | (1805.10918v3)

Abstract: Let njn_j be a lacunary sequence of integers, such that nj+1/njrn_{j+1}/n_j\geq r. We are interested in linear combinations of the sequence of finite Riesz products j=1<sup>N(1+cos(nj</sup>t))\prod_{j=1}<sup>N(1+\cos(n_j</sup> t)). We prove that, whenever the Riesz products are normalized in L<sup>pL<sup>p norm (p1p\geq 1) and when rr is large enough, the L<sup>pL<sup>p norm of such a linear combination is equivalent to the <sup>p\ell<sup>p norm of the sequence of coefficients. In other words, one can describe many ways of embedding <sup>p\ell<sup>p into L<sup>pL<sup>p based on Fourier coefficients. This generalizes to vector valued L<sup>pL<sup>p spaces.
